# Transporting Stage Props — Lanternfall Touring Show

Props travel under the same rules as archive documents: sealed crates, signed manifest, no loose items. The papier-mâché crown goes in its own padded box — it's fragile and irreplaceable mid-tour. Records team logs crate numbers on departure and arrival. Hallis Vanlines handles the leg to Greymoor. The confidential courier hand-over instruction is noted just below.

handover note for yagef-bagep: the drudor pelius courier leaves the kasdor zorvan norir ledger at gate 8016 under passcode 755406

MEMO — Pilot with Farrowdale Stores

To the heads of department: the eight-week pilot of our Quartwell shelf-analytics system begins next month across six Farrowdale locations. Installation schedules are confirmed, and store staff training is arranged. Please keep external communication minimal until results are validated. The broader intent behind this pilot is set out in the note below.

internal memo for tajof-kaduf: Only 65 of the 511 pilot accounts renewed Lamdor, so a churn review is set for January 26. Aldmirek Works is in early talks to buy Alddorox Works for about $490.9 million.

## v2.8.3

Fixed: websocket clients on Brampton Relay failed to reconnect after idle timeouts longer than 90 seconds. Root cause was a stale heartbeat token cached in the reconnect handler. The fix regenerates the token on every retry attempt and adds jittered backoff capped at 30s. New team members: see the socket-lifecycle doc in the wiki before touching this code path. Regression tests added under `relay/reconnect`. Questions about this patch go to the engineer listed below.

account owner for bawip-tahag: Raleth Quenok

Leadership Review Briefing — Cranstead Lease

Quick update for the board: we've reopened talks on the Cranstead warehouse lease. The landlord's opening position is a 12% uplift; we're countering with a longer term at flat rates. Ops says the site is still the right fit. Where this fits in our plans is covered in the note below.

internal memo for yahof-bajop: Tamethox Group is in early talks to buy Ulamirek Group for about $64.0 million. The Aldiel launch date is October 11, and nothing goes to the press before then.